Anton Basistov wrote:
> I'am going to migrate from Communigate to Courier mail server. > Tell me please: > Did any body do such things? What difficulties are waiting for me? > Most of all I'd like to know, how to migrate users to courier with > u-cript passwords from Communigate? > Must I write some kind of script by myself, or may be there are > special utils? I have about 300 users. > And how can I move mail between boxes? > Systems: freeBSD. It depends on a few things. First, what mail storage are you using for the Communigate accounts? I believe Communigate supports Maildir as well as mbox, Courier only supports Maildir which is the much faster and more reliable of the two. You'll need to convert any mbox mailbox over to Maildir. Also, what backend authentication method are you using in Communigate and do you plan to use in Courier? If you already have something like LDAP, things should be easy.
